-- Use an on_attach function to only map the following keys
-- after the language server attaches to the current buffer
local common_on_attach = function(client, bufnr)
local function buf_set_keymap(...)
vim.api.nvim_buf_set_keymap(bufnr, ...)
end
local function buf_set_option(...)
vim.api.nvim_buf_set_option(bufnr, ...)
end
--client.resolved_capabilities.document_formatting = false
--client.resolved_capabilities.document_range_formatting = false
-- Enable completion triggered by <c-x><c-o>
buf_set_option("omnifunc", "v:lua.vim.lsp.omnifunc")
-- Mappings.
local opts = {noremap = true, silent = true}
-- See `:help vim.lsp.*` for documentation on any of the below functions
--buf_set_keymap("n", "<C-k>",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.signature_help()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>D",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.type_definition()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>ca",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.code_action()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>e", "<cmd>lua vim.diagnostic.show_line_diagnostics()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>F",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.formatting()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>q", "<cmd>lua vim.diagnostic.set_loclist()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>rn",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.rename()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>wa",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.add_workspace_folder()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>wl", "<cmd>lua print(vim.inspect(vim.lsp.buf.list_workspace_folders()))<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<space>wr",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.remove_workspace_folder()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"K",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.hover()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<C-[>", "<cmd>lua vim.diagnostic.goto_prev({wrap = true})<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"<C-]>", "<cmd>lua vim.diagnostic.goto_next({wrap = true})<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"gD",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.declaration()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"gd",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.definition()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"gi",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.implementation()<CR>", opts)
buf_set_keymap("n", "gr", "<cmd>lua vim.lsp.buf.references()<CR>", opts)
end
